About CrewBoss
CrewBoss is the brand of choice among professional Wildland firefighters because of the superior comfort, fit, quality construction, functional features and long-lasting performance of every CrewBoss product. Long the standard by which all fireline clothing is judged, CrewBoss garments continue to be designed with the direct input of the Wildland professionals who rely on our products. An ISO 9001

What Is the Cost of Living Near Eugene?

Understanding the cost of living near Eugene is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at CrewBoss.
Eugene's Cost of Living Index is approximately 104.8 (4.8% more expensive than US average; 8.9% less than OR average). Home to Univ. of Oregon, 'Track Town USA', housing costs above US avg. LTD bus, EmX BRT. When planning your budget based on a salary from CrewBoss,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$1,200 - $1,800+ A significant portion of CrewBoss sal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$110 - $200 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$50 (LTD monthly pass, free for UO)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$430 - $630 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$400 - $730+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$380 - $700+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$2,570 - $4,060+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
